On July 24, 2025, Vice Foreign Minister Sun Weidong exchanged views with ASEAN Secretary-General Kao Kim Hourn, who was visiting China, on China-ASEAN cooperation and other matters.
Sun Weidong stated that amid the current international situation intertwined with changes and chaos, regional countries should unite and cooperate to meet challenges together, jointly safeguard peace, tranquility, development, and prosperity of the region. Regional countries must firmly uphold free trade and the multilateral trading system, promote mutual reinforcement among various free trade arrangements, and resist unilateralism with openness and inclusiveness. Regional countries should carry forward the Five Principles of Peaceful Coexistence and the Bandung Spirit, respect each other, engage in dialogue and consultation, seek common ground while shelving differences, and jointly maintain the hard-won peace and stability in the region. Regional countries should properly handle the South China Sea issue and foster a new narrative of peace, friendship, and cooperation in the South China Sea. China is willing to work with ASEAN to actively promote East Asian cooperation, continuously advance the development of a peaceful, safe and secure, prosperous, beautiful and amicable home, and build an even closer China-ASEAN community with a shared future.
Kao Kim Hourn stated that the ASEAN-China cooperation is strategically far-sighted, and the Version 3.0 ASEAN-China Free Trade Area will further enhance the level of economic and trade cooperation between the two sides. The more China develops, the more the region benefits. ASEAN is willing to work with China to firmly uphold the multilateral trading system with the WTO at its core, accelerate the consultation on the Code of Conduct in the South China Sea, and jointly maintain regional peace and stability. ASEAN looks forward to taking the 5th anniversary of the establishment of the ASEAN-China comprehensive strategic partnership in 2026 as an opportunity to bring bilateral cooperation to new heights and benefit the people of all countries in the region.
